#d1ed5e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d1ed5e is composed of 82% red, 92.9%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 60.3%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 71.7 degrees, a saturation of 79.9% and a lightness of 64.9%. #d1ed5e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ffbc with #a3db00. Closest websafe color is: #ccff66.

Shades and Tints of #d1ed5e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0f02 is the darkest color, while #fefff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#d1ed5e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a7a8a3 is the less saturated color, while #d9fb50 is the most saturated one.
